The Periodic Table of Cover Crops

Content Source: ATTRA

Resource Explained

This visual reference tool, produced by ATTRA NCAT, organizes cover crop species in a periodic table format, providing eight key data points for each plant including function, root type, plant structure, crude protein, life cycle, biomass per pound of seed, and carbon-to-nitrogen ratio. Organized by seasonality, plant type, and water demand, it helps producers quickly identify the most suitable cover crops.
